SOTCW (Society of Twentieth Century Wargamers) magazine - The Journal issue 62 is now hitting doorsteps across the world.
Issue 62 has as its theme Hitler's Neutral Ally - The Spanish volunteer "Blue Division" - 250th Infantry Division. We have a detailed wartime history and TO&E of the division, which served on the Eastern Front from October 1941-October 1943, though some Spanish volunteers stayed on until the fall of Berlin! We provide a guide to uniforms and equipment to create your own "Blue Division" troops on the tabletop. Phil Gray gives details on the Blue Squadrons that flew with the Luftwaffe, and finally, Richard Clarke (TooFatLardies) and Steven Thomas (balagan.org.uk) provide us with some excellent scenarios.
The rest of this issue features - The last part of Chris Stoesen's early Negev Campaign, a fine article on "The Football War" between El Salvador and Honduras in 1969 with a scenario for Check Your 6!; David Manley provides a set of rules for fast-attack craft; John Moher (author of Modern Spearhead) provides a detailed TO&E for the Hermann Goring Division in Tunisia, Stuart Emmett of C-P Models has sent us a guide to painting 20mm figures, and we wrap things up with a couple of scenarios - Mons 1914 and Poland 1939.
There are, of course, all the usual review columns and letters, too.
